Toon posts:

[cli] rtf2pdf

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ik ben op zoek naar een command line applicatie die rtf documentjes kan omtoveren tot pdf. Ik heb totnogtoe geprobeerd:
- rtf2pdf.sh van Ted: deze knoeit verschrikkelijk met fonts en mn euro teken gaat verloren :'(. Tabellen gaan perfect.
- oowriter -pt "PDF converter": Werkt ietsje beter (nog steeds slechte fonts), maar het is de bedoeling dat het in een serveromgeving gaat draaien en oo.o installeren lijkt me dan een beetje overbodig.
- wvware: Deze kan totaal niet met RTF bestandjes als input overweg.

Ik krijg het idee dat de slechte fonts bij rtf2pdf en oowriter komen door een foute config van gs, maar het afdrukken naar een printer gaat wel goed.

Ik doe het het liefste op de rtf2pdf.sh manier, maar ik heb zelf geen idee hoe ik mijn euro teken kan behouden en gs wat beter kan laten werken.

Heeft iemand suggesties :)?

Verwijderd

Zoek eens een tooltje die (met behoud van het euroteken) RTF files kan converteren naar PostScript.

Dan kun je van PostScript weer makkelijk (met GhostScript) PDF's maken.

Vermoedelijk is dit de methode die rtf2pdf gebruikt.

Heb je op je $OS een tool die RTFs kan renderen naar het beeldscherm? Check dan of de euro-tekens in de RTF fonts bestaan.

Kun je PS en/of PDF renderen (gv, xpdf, acroread), kijk dan of een euro teken in die formaten werken.

Dat laatste kun je testen door een HTML document met een € teken erin af te drukken (Netscape/Linux?) naar een file, om een PS output te krijgen. Dit resultaat op het scherm toveren, en dan met ps2pdf converteren naar PDF en daarvan ook het resultaat bekijken.

Verwijderd

Topicstarter
Verwijderd schreef op 05 mei 2004 @ 18:52:
Zoek eens een tooltje die (met behoud van het euroteken) RTF files kan converteren naar PostScript.
Die heb ik ook nog niet kunnen vinden

Dan kun je van PostScript weer makkelijk (met GhostScript) PDF's maken.

Vermoedelijk is dit de methode die rtf2pdf gebruikt.
Zo doet rtf2pdf het idd, maar Ted (rtf editor) kan niet met het euro teken (\'80) overweg en gs vernaggelt de fonts

Heb je op je $OS een tool die RTFs kan renderen naar het beeldscherm? Check dan of de euro-tekens in de RTF fonts bestaan.
In Ted werkt het euro teken niet; oo.o werkt perfect, maar vind ik te zwaar

Kun je PS en/of PDF renderen (gv, xpdf, acroread), kijk dan of een euro teken in die formaten werken.
Dit kan dus wel, als ik bijvoorbeeld met oo.o exporteer naar pdf

Dat laatste kun je testen door een HTML document met een € teken erin af te drukken (Netscape/Linux?) naar een file, om een PS output te krijgen. Dit resultaat op het scherm toveren, en dan met ps2pdf converteren naar PDF en daarvan ook het resultaat bekijken.

  • Sir Isaac
  • Registratie: September 2002
  • Laatst online: 21-05-2025
Ik vermoed dat rtf2pdf latex gebruikt. Correct? Als dat zo is zou je rtf2pdf zo kunnen aanpassen (ik neem aan dat het een script is), dat hij \usepackage{pslatex} na \documentclass{whatever} maar voor \begin{document} zet. Dan gebruikt latex (en dus rtf2pdf) postscript fonts ipv de standaard LaTeX bitmap fonts.